Warning: To install a FlexNet license server, administrator rights are required. Lmadmin provides improved methods of managing the license server and vendor daemons.įor complete technical details, please refer to FlexNet Publisher – License Administration Guide chapter 9, section “ lmadmin License Server Manager“. Here is the link to the FAQ section where you can find the documentation on “How to use lmgrd as an alternative of lmadmin”. You can use lmgrd to manage your FlexNet license server but it uses older technology, and may become deprecated.

If your site already has a FlexNet license server running that is used for licensing other vendors’ products, this may affect where and how you decide to configure the FEI Software license server.įor more information, please refer to FlexNet Publisher – License Administration Guide chapter 18 “ Managing Licenses from Multiple Software Publishers“. For instance, the FlexNet server could be on a Linux box, with the users running the FEI Software on a Windows platform. That is, the server and the FEI Software can be running on different operating systems. It is possible to do FlexNet licensing in a heterogeneous environment. The server can be installed on a computer on which the FEI Software is installed, but it does not have to be. This system should be “visible” from any system that might want to request a license. It can require configuration of firewalls and an in-depth knowledge of the network configuration at your site. Warning: Installation and management of floating licenses is not a trivial undertaking.
The advantage of this approach is that, unlike node-locked licensing, the product is not locked to a specific computer, but can be run on any computer that can communicate with the license server.įlexNet license server architecture example
The FlexNet license server tracks the licenses being used and allows simultaneous use of up to N instances of the software. In this scenario, you have purchased a specific number, N, of product licenses. For FlexNet 11.14 Installing, Configuring, and Administrating a FlexNet License ServerįEI’s software products Avizo, Amira and PerGeos ( referred to below as “FEI Software”) use the FlexNet licensing tool for supporting floating licenses.
